摘要:
目的 探讨三酰甘油葡萄糖乘积指数(TyG指数)及LDL-C/HDL-C比率与2型糖尿病(T2DM)合并冠心病(CHD)的相关性。方法 选择2016年12月-2018年7月就诊于我院疑诊为CHD并行冠状动脉造影检查的T2DM患者387例,依据冠状动脉造影结果将确诊为CHD的患者设为研究组(283例),无CHD的患者设为对照组(104例),记录患者的临床资料、生化检测指标及冠状动脉影像学资料,并计算TyG指数、LDL-C/HDL-C比率及Gensini评分;比较两组临床资料、TyG指数、LDL-C/HDL-C比率,采用受试者工作特征曲线(ROC)评估TyG指数、LDL-C/HDL-C比率对T2DM合并CHD的诊断价值,并确定最佳截断值;Logistic回归分析T2DM合并CHD的危险因素;Spearman相关性分析TyG指数、LDL-C/HDL-C比率与Gensini评分的相关性。结果 研究组TyG指数、LDL-C/HDL-C比率均高于对照组(P<0.05);ROC曲线分析显示,TyG指数、LDL-C/HDL-C比率诊断T2DM合并CHD的曲线下面积(AUC)分别为0.646和0.651,当TyG指数、LDL-C/HDL-C比率分别取截断值7.170、2.080时,诊断T2DM合并CHD的效能最高,诊断的敏感度和特异度分别为44.50%、84.60%和55.20%、71.40%;Logistic回归分析显示,TyG指数≥7.170、LDL-C/HDL-C比率≥2.080是T2DM合并CHD的独立危险因素(P<0.05);Spearman相关性分析显示,TyG指数、LDL-C/HDL-C比率与Gensini评分呈正相关(r=0.114、0.152,P<0.05)。结论 TyG指数、LDL-C/HDL-C比率对诊断T2DM合并CHD具有提示意义,是T2DM合并CHD的独立危险因素,与T2DM患者的冠脉病变程度呈正相关。
Abstract:
Objective To investigate the correlation of triglyceride glucose product index (TyG index) and LDL-C/HDL-C ratio with type 2 diabetes mellitus (T2DM) complicated with coronary heart disease (CHD).Methods A total of 387 patients with T2DM who were suspected to be CHD and underwent coronary angiography in our hospital from December 2016 to July 2018 were selected. According to the results of coronary angiography, the patients diagnosed as CHD were set as the study group (283 cases), and the patients without CHD were set as the control group (104 cases). The clinical data, biochemical detection indexes and coronary artery imaging data of all patients were recorded, and the TyG index, LDL-C/HDL-C ratio and Gensini score were calculated. The clinical data, TyG index and LDL-C/HDL-C ratio were compared between the two groups. The receiver operating characteristic curve (ROC) was used to evaluate the diagnostic value of TyG index and LDL-C/HDL-C ratio for T2DM with CHD, and the optimal cutoff value was determined. Logistic regression analysis of T2DM with CHD risk factors; Spearman correlation analysis of TyG index, LDL-C/HDL-C ratio and Gensini score.Results The TyG index and LDL-C/HDL-C ratio in the study group were higher than those in the control group (P<0.05). ROC curve analysis showed that the area under the curve (AUC) of TyG index and LDL-C/HDL-C ratio in the diagnosis of T2DM combined with CHD were 0.646 and 0.651, respectively. When the cut-off values of TyG index and LDL-C/HDL-C ratio were 7.170 and 2.080, respectively, the diagnostic efficacy of T2DM combined with CHD was the highest, and the diagnostic sensitivity and specificity were 44.50%, 84.60% and 55.20%, 71.40%, respectively. Logistic regression analysis showed that TyG index≥7.170 and LDL-C/HDL-C ratio≥2.080 were independent risk factors for T2DM combined with CHD (P<0.05). Spearman correlation analysis showed that TyG index and LDL-C/HDL-C ratio were positively correlated with Gensini score (r=0.114, 0.152, P<0.05).Conclusion TyG index and LDL-C / HDL-C ratio are of significance for the diagnosis of T2DM complicated with CHD, which are independent risk factors for T2DM complicated with CHD and are positively correlated with the severity of coronary artery lesions in T2DM patients.
